Bollywood actress Karisma Kapoor’s ex-husband Sanjay Kapoor died of a heart attack. The incident happened during a match when he was playing polo when he suffered a heart attack. However, he was immediately taken to the hospital, where doctors declared him dead. Sanjay Kapoor was married to Karisma Kapoor, with whom he has two children – daughter Samaira and son Kian. Currently his wife is Priya Sachdev.

The cause of death is said to be a heart attack

Actor Suhail Seth, who was close to Sanjay Kapoor, has shared this news on the internet media. Suhail wrote on X, deeply saddened by the demise of Sanjay Kapoor, he passed away in England on Thursday morning. Deepest condolences to his family and colleagues.

Sanjay Kapoor was the CEO of Sixt India

The cause of Sanjay Kapoor’s death is said to be a heart attack. He was an industrialist and CEO of Sixt India. He was previously married to Karisma, with whom he has two children, daughter Samaira and son Kian.

On 29 September 2003, the two got married in a high-profile Sikh wedding ceremony at the actress’ ancestral home Krishna Raj Bungalow in Mumbai. In 2014, the couple filed for divorce by mutual consent. The couple got divorced in 2016.
